manik Feb 9, 2007 7:43 AM (in response to eonnen)There never have been specific installation instructions, you basically just use the new jars in the distro to overwrite the jars in your current distro.
May be a good idea to wiki-ise some of these steps though; let me know if you feel like doing this.
Re: compat, see the compat matrix on http://labs.jboss.org/jbosscache -
